Metamaterials Market to Soar Driven by Nanotechnology Advancements
Metamaterials are artificially engineered composites designed to exhibit electromagnetic, acoustic, and mechanical properties not found in natural materials. By arranging subwavelength structural units—often referred to as “meta-atoms”—in periodic patterns, these materials enable unprecedented control over wave propagation, refraction, and absorption. Key advantages include negative refractive index, cloaking capabilities, ultra-high resolution imaging, and vibration attenuation. Such unique characteristics address critical needs across telecommunications (e.g., beam steering in 5G networks), aerospace and defense (radar cross-section reduction and antenna miniaturization), healthcare (advanced MRI and ultrasound imaging), and energy (enhanced photovoltaic efficiency). As industries demand lighter, more efficient, and highly adaptable components, metamaterials deliver compact form factors and tunable performance.
